BEWARE

We visited for 5 days in early December and our initial and closing impressions were poor. First, the Turinter people were not easy to find nor were they knowledgeable about who was to be transferred. They also didn't know what people were going to which hotels. We had to inform the driver where to deliver us. The hotel lobby was mass confusion with no lines forming to be checked in. After filling out forms we were told our room would be ready in 40 minutes. It was 4 p.m. The biggest surprise in our junior deluxe suite with ocean view: two double beds (our package included a king bed) and a non-functioning mini-bar, totally warm. We spent the next several hours on the phone trying to get what we paid for. We were continually passed on to the next person, supposedly a manager. We tried to speak with hotel staff in person and got the same reaction: "We are full, no king beds until tomorrow at 4." Finally, 24 hours later we were moved to a room with a king bed and functioning bar. The ocean view is not worth the extra cost since you need binoculars to see the ocean from your room. When we went to arrange our transfer to the airport on the last day, Turinter rep was nowhere to be found. We waited 2 hours. Hotel staff tried calling for us, reluctantly, complaining about the cost of the 800 call. On checkout, staff tried to charge us 550 pesos from the old room, a bill run up by the people who moved in after we moved out. In sum, the beach is great, the grounds beautiful, the staff unresponsive to essential needs. No one had the decency to apologize or reassure us that they were trying to remedy the problems.

Not a 4 star resort

Maybe it is because they haven't been open that long, but the service was not good. Staff seemed uninterested in helping and unhappy. The food in the buffets was not good. Most of it seemed like it was sitting around too long - especially the breakfast french toast, pancakes and eggs. The Spanish restaurant was the best we tried. The French restaurant plays some weird game with reservations and we were unable to get in. Other restaurants got our orders wrong or took too long to bring the main course. I would have preferred more private doors on the WC in the room. Thefacility is beautiful and so is the beach. I hope they can get their act together, make some improvements and do some staff training. We did not have a good experience with Turinter Tours. They didn't tell us when we had to be in the lobby for the van to the airport until the last minute. When the van was late there was no one to ask what happened or what we should do. They came eventually but we didn't need the aggravation.
